Browsing the Features Landscape: What to Look for in a Robot Hoover
Picking the best robot hoover involves thinking about a number of crucial functions to ensure it meets your specific requirements and home environment. Here's a breakdown of vital aspects to assess:
Navigation System: This is the "brain" of the robot hoover.
Random Bounce Navigation: Basic models use this system, bouncing randomly around the space until they cover the area. They are less effective and might miss spots.Systematic Navigation (Line-by-Line or Room-by-Room): More innovative models utilize sensing units and mapping technology (like gyroscopes, electronic cameras, or LiDAR) to clean up in a structured pattern. This is much more efficient and makes sure extensive coverage.Mapping and Room Recognition: Premium designs produce a map of your home, enabling zoned cleaning, virtual boundaries, and room-specific cleaning schedules. This is perfect for bigger homes or those with particular cleaning needs for different rooms.
Suction Power and Cleaning Performance: Suction power determines how effectively the robot hoover gets dirt and particles.
Think about floor types: Homes with carpets require greater suction power than those with primarily difficult floors.Pet Hair Specific Models: Look for models particularly designed for pet hair, typically including more powerful suction and specialized brush rolls.
Battery Life and Charging: Battery life determines the period of a cleaning cycle.
Consider your home size: Larger homes need longer battery life.Auto-Recharge and Resume: Many designs instantly go back to their charging dock when the battery is low and can resume cleaning where they left off. This is a crucial feature for bigger homes or longer cleaning cycles.
Dustbin Capacity and Emptying: The dustbin size figures out how frequently you need to empty it.
Bigger dustbins require less frequent emptying.Self-Emptying Docks: Some high-end models feature self-emptying docks that immediately empty the robot's dustbin into a bigger container, more lowering maintenance frequency.
Brush System: The brush system is crucial for reliable debris removal.
Main Brush Roll: Look for a mix brush roll (bristles and rubber fins) for effective cleaning on both carpets and difficult floorings.Side Brushes: Side brushes assist sweep debris from edges and corners into the course of the primary brush.
Purification System: The filtering system captures dust and allergens.
HEPA Filters: Essential for allergy victims, HEPA filters trap fine dust particles and irritants, enhancing air quality.
Smart Features and App Control: Modern robot hoovers typically include smart features and app control.
Scheduling: Set cleaning schedules for particular times and days.Zone Cleaning: Define specific areas to tidy or avoid.Virtual Boundaries: Create unnoticeable walls to prevent the robot from getting in certain locations.Voice Control Integration: Some designs incorporate with vo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ant.
Obstacle Avoidance and Cliff Sensors:
Obstacle Avoidance: Advanced sensors help robotics navigate around furniture and challenges successfully, lessening bumping and getting stuck.Cliff Sensors: Prevent the robot from dropping stairs or edges.
Noise Level: Robot hoovers vary in sound level. Consider designs with quieter operation if sound sensitivity is a concern.
Checking out the Spectrum: Types of Robot Hoovers Available
Robot hoovers can be broadly classified based on their functions and capabilities, often reflecting various price points and target audiences.
Here are some typical categories:
Entry-Level Robot Hoovers: These are typically more affordable models with basic random bounce navigation, decent suction, and necessary features like cliff sensors. They are suitable for smaller homes or those new to robot hoovers looking for a basic cleaning service.Mid-Range Robot Hoovers: These models offer a balance of features and cost. They often incorporate systematic navigation, stronger suction, app control, and potentially zoned cleaning. They are a great option for most average-sized homes and use an obvious upgrade in cleaning effectiveness and benefit.High-End Robot Hoovers: These are the premium models packed with advanced functions like LiDAR or camera-based mapping, advanced challenge avoidance, self-emptying docks, advanced app control, and remarkable cleaning performance. They are ideal for larger homes, homes with animals, or those seeking the supreme in robotic cleaning technology and minimal upkeep.Robot Mops: While some robot hoovers offer mopping performance, dedicated robot mops are developed particularly for difficult floor mopping. They typically use water tanks and mopping pads to clean spills and stains. Some combination robot vacuum and mops are offered, offering both cleaning functions in one gadget.
Keeping Your Autonomous Assistant: Care and Longevity
To ensure your robot hoover continues to carry out efficiently and lasts for many years to come, routine upkeep is vital.
Here are essential maintenance jobs:
Empty the Dustbin Regularly: Empty the dustbin after each cleaning cycle or as required. A complete dustbin reduces suction power and cleaning effectiveness.Tidy the Brushes: Regularly eliminate and clean hair and particles tangled around the primary brush and side brushes. This avoids obstruction and ensures reliable debris pickup.Tidy the Filters: Clean or change the filters according to the producer's recommendations. Tidy filters keep great suction and air quality.Wipe Down Sensors: Periodically wipe down the sensors (cliff sensing units, wall sensing units, etc) with a soft, dry cloth to ensure they operate properly for navigation and challenge avoidance.Examine and Clean Wheels: Ensure the wheels are devoid of particles and can rotate efficiently for ideal navigation.Change Parts as Needed: Brush rolls, filters, and sometimes batteries will require replacement with time. Follow the manufacturer's suggestions for replacement intervals to maintain peak performance.
Regularly Asked Questions About Robot Hoovers
Are robot hoovers effective at cleaning? Yes, robot hoovers are efficient at day-to-day upkeep cleaning and keeping floorings consistently tidy. While they may not change deep cleaning totally, they considerably decrease the frequency and effort needed for manual vacuuming.Can robot hoovers deal with pet hair? Lots of robot hoovers are particularly developed for pet hair, featuring stronger suction and specialized brush rolls to effectively pick up pet hair and dander. Search for models marketed as "pet-friendly."Do robot hoovers deal with carpets and tough floorings? The majority of modern-day robot hoovers are developed to work on both carpets and difficult floors. Many automatically adjust suction power based on the floor type.Will a robot hoover drop the stairs? No, a lot of robot hoovers are geared up with cliff sensing units that identify edges and prevent them from falling down stairs or ledges.For how long do robot hoovers last? The lifespan of a robot hoover varies depending on the design, usage, and upkeep. With appropriate care, many robot hoovers can last for a number of years.Are robot hoovers noisy? Robot hoovers are typically quieter than traditional vacuum cleaners, however noise levels differ by design. Look for decibel scores if sound is a substantial concern.Can I manage my robot hoover from another location? Numerous modern-day robot hoovers provide smart device app control, enabling you to set up cleans up, start/stop cycles remotely, and display cleaning progress.
